Some of the slums are regularized and kind-of within the law. The tight packed slum is a periphery--extreme cases. We must be aware that this is the extreme, but this is wrong that we have these giant extremes. We often have invisible divisions, but the urban forces it to be visible. China is adding the rural internal to the urban. This is similar to what the dutch did a while ago--going vertical. Surfaces of cities and interiors of cities are undergoing large transitions. Our urban future-3billion people (40%) will need proper housing and access to basic infrastructure and services. In some cities, up to 80% of pop lives in slums. Largest slum in the us was in san fransisco for years--mostly former silicon valley. Us has slums, they are just dressed up. With the displacement of the latino community in manhatanville, the local micro-economy was devastated and led to impoverishment.
